(b) There can be no rules.

John goes out at night, and his parents stipulate that he must go home before 10. But one day, John didn't come home at the appointed time. He didn't come back until after midnight. When he got home, he jumped into the house from the back window for fear that his parents would find out. The next morning, when my father saw a stool under the window, he called John and said, "It's dangerous for you to do this. It's not that I'm afraid of falling, but that others may shoot if they find someone jumping from the window. " In America, this is the most dangerous. Then, my father reiterated the rule of coming home on time and told him the reason. The old grandfather said meaningfully, "children grow bigger and bigger like cows, and they need more and more pastures." But regardless of the size of the ranch, we still have to enclose it. "

Life can't be without rules. Rules are the traffic lights of life. This seems to be a restriction, but it is actually a protection. Traffic lights are the commanders of urban traffic. If it is not controlled, the whole city will fall into chaos. People are the same, without the restriction of "traffic lights", there will be lawlessness and disaster.

Long Yongtu, the chief negotiator of China's entry into WTO, and some friends are walking in the Swiss Park. When he went to the toilet, he heard a "bang" in the compartment and was puzzled. What's going on here? After coming out, a lady said anxiously that her son had not come out after going into the toilet for more than ten minutes, and she asked him to have a look. Long Yongtu turned back to the bathroom and opened the "Bang Bang" compartment. He saw a seven-or eight-year-old child working on the toilet, but he couldn't flush and was so tired that he was sweating all over. You see, even children know that it is against the rules not to flush the toilet. Respecting and obeying the rules is an education, a etiquette, a civilization and an essential character of a modern person. Without these, people can't survive and stand in society. Without rules, society cannot be harmonious and peaceful.

The old locksmith has repaired locks countless times in his life, and his skills are superb and his fees are reasonable, which is deeply respected by people.

The old locksmith is old. In order not to lose his skill, he chose two young people and prepared to pass on his skill to them.

After a period of time, both young people learned a lot of skills. But only one of them can get the true biography, so the old locksmith decided to give them an exam.

The old locksmith has prepared two safes for two apprentices to open. Whoever spends a short time will win. As a result, it took the first disciple less than 10 minutes to open the safe, while the second disciple took half an hour.

The old locksmith asked his apprentice, "What's in the safe?" The big disciple's eyes lit up: "Master, there is a lot of money in it, all of which are hundred-dollar bills." Asked the second disciple the same question, the second disciple hesitated for a long time and said, "Master, I didn't see anything in it. No sooner had you asked me to unlock the lock than I opened it. "

The old locksmith said with a smile: "In fact, no matter what industry you are engaged in, you must talk about the word' trust', especially in our line, and you must have a higher professional ethics. I accepted my apprentice and trained him to be a skilled locksmith. He must have a lock in his heart and nothing else, turning a blind eye to money. Otherwise, selfish and greedy, it is easy to go to the door or open the safe to withdraw money, and ultimately only harm others and themselves. Everyone who repairs locks must have a lock that cannot be opened. " Say that finish, solemnly declare (big apprentice, second apprentice) as his official successor.
